ANI LIU: DAUGHTER OF INVENTION At a young age, Ani Liu had to disguise her art as science. Now she combines them. HOWARD JACOBSON: SENESCENCE AND SENSIBILITY Howard Jacobson is now a pillar of English literature and society. But this was never anything he would have predicted. EDGAR MEYER: BEYOND THE BASS-ICS Historically, repertoire for the double bass has been extremely limited. The acclaimed performer, collaborator, and composer Edgar Meyer is out to change that.

ARTICULATE WITH JIM COTTER is an arts magazine series, hosted by award-winning journalist Jim Cotter, that explores the variety, quality and heritage of creativity, while also showing how art speaks to us in our everyday lives.
The fresh and unique stories featured in the 12-part series include: the history of tap dancing as a cross-cultural art form; the work of multimedia artist Sam Durant; the role of improvisation in dance with choreographer Matthew Neenan; and the on-stage work and off-stage educational efforts of French pianist Claire-Marie Le Guay.
